No one wants to deal with a malfunctioning appliance, but it happens. And when it does, it can be quite a hassle, so, of course, you want the repair visit to go as smoothly as possible. Here are a few ways you can make that happen.

1. Prepare Your Schedule
It may take your repair tech only moments to make the repairs, but it could take hours – depending on the parts they need.

Most repairmen have the most commonly-needed parts and tools on them. However, sometimes, they need to go pick something up or even order necessities.

Additionally, the specific issue can dictate the length of time they need. For example, simply needing to swap out an easily accessible part shouldn’t take long. However, if they need to take the appliance apart, it’s going to take much longer.

In short, it’s best to keep your schedule as open as possible for the day of your repairs. And if they finish quickly enough, you have some time open for yourself.

2. Prepare Your Home
You don’t have to have a spotless house to undergo repairs, but there are a couple of things you can do to make it easier.

Make sure the appliance is accessible: For instance, if your washer or dryer needs repairs, don’t have all of your dirty laundry baskets sitting directly in front of them. Also, make sure the path from the door to the appliance is free of clutter.

Have the appliance cleaned: This isn’t about impressing the repairman. It’s about making sure they can accurately assess the issue. For example, take any laundry out of your washer and dryer. Or if your fridge needs repairs, make sure it’s not overstuffed. You need to keep your food cold, of course, but try to make sure the repairman has space to actually look in your fridge if needed.

3. Prepare Pets and Little Ones
If you have young children or pets in the home, you want to keep them occupied in another area. This is for a couple of reasons.

Most importantly, you want to keep them safe. While your repairman will do their utmost to keep everyone out of harm’s way, accidents happen. Keeping pets and little ones out of the work area can go a long way in ensuring their safety.

Also, you don’t want anything interfering with the repairman’s ability to get the job done. Four-legged creatures and babies and toddlers can be distracting, especially while the repairman is trying to prevent any danger to them. It’s easier and faster if they can get in and focus solely on their job.

4. Prepare Paperwork
In some cases, you’ll need to show the repairman your warranty or any work invoices for previous repairs. Having this type of paperwork within reach is much easier than having to find it on the spot.
